Fish, pollock, raw vs. Fish, haddock, raw vs. Fish, tuna, light, canned in water, drained solids

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.

Fish, tuna, light, canned in water, drained solids has the most protein of the foods compared, at 19 g per 100g.

Nutrient Fish, pollock, raw Fish, haddock, raw Fish, tuna, light, canned in water,…
Protein 12.3 G16.3 G19 G
Total lipid (fat) 0.41 G0.45 G0.94 G
Carbohydrate, by difference 0 G0 G0.08 G
Energy 56 KCAL74 KCAL90 KCAL
Calcium, Ca 15 MG11 MG18 MG
Iron, Fe 0.22 MG0.17 MG1.7 MG
Potassium, K 160 MG286 MG176 MG
Sodium, Na 333 MG213 MG219 MG
Vitamin D (D2 + D3), International Units 8 IU18 IU47 IU
Cholesterol 46 MG54 MG36 MG
Fatty acids, total trans 0.02 G0 G0 G
Fatty acids, total saturated 0.13 G0.09 G0.22 G
